Cleansing forms the cornerstone of any skin care regimen. Removing dirt, makeup, sweat, and pollutants prevents clogged pores, breakouts, and dullness while preparing the skin to absorb moisturizers and treatments more effectively. The choice of cleanser should reflect the skin type: gentle, non-foaming cleansers for dry or sensitive skin and foaming or gel-based cleansers for oily skin. Double cleansing, which combines an oil-based cleanser followed by a water-based one, has gained popularity for thoroughly eliminating impurities without compromising natural moisture. Proper cleansing establishes a clean, refreshed canvas for the rest of the routine, maximizing the effectiveness of subsequent products.
Exfoliation encourages the skin’s natural renewal process by removing dead skin cells and promoting cell turnover. This process enhances texture, reveals a brighter complexion, and allows serums and moisturizers to penetrate more deeply. Physical exfoliants, such as scrubs, and chemical exfoliants, including alpha hydroxy acids and beta hydroxy acids, can achieve these results, though chemical exfoliants are often preferred for sensitive or delicate skin due to their gentler, more consistent action. Regular exfoliation supports long-term radiance, while over-exfoliation can compromise the skin barrier, leading to sensitivity, redness, or dryness.
Moisturization and hydration are key to maintaining elasticity, softness, and resilience. Serums, creams, and gels containing ingredients like hyaluronic acid, ceramides, glycerin, and natural oils lock in moisture, strengthen the skin barrier, and protect against environmental stressors. Sunscreen is an essential addition, shielding the skin from harmful UV rays that accelerate aging, cause pigmentation, and damage skin health. Consistent use of moisturizers and sun protection preserves youthful skin while enhancing natural radiance.
Targeted treatments help address specific concerns such as acne, fine lines, dark spots, or dullness. Ingredients like vitamin C, retinol, niacinamide, and peptides support cell regeneration, improve tone, and reduce inflammation when incorporated appropriately.
